What is the volume of a 64.8 g rectangular solid with a density of 1.74 g/cm3

Answer:

The answer is 37.24 cm³

Explanation:

The volume of a substance when given the density and mass can be found by using the formula

[tex]volume = \frac{mass}{density} \\ [/tex]

From the question we have

[tex]volume = \frac{64.8}{1.74} \\ = 37.2413793...[/tex]

We have the final answer as

37.24 cm³
